Pros

- quick to make important decisions - flexible and agile (large organizations are slooooow to do anything) - keen to encourage and keep the working culture fun (and serious when required) - Axomic dinners are great fun and create a team bond

Cons

- communication on product changes has been lacking in the past - not everyone in the company has a feel for how we're doing revenue wise
